29 | help = 'exports a series of patches to <dir> (or patches)' | |
26aab5b0 CM |
30 | usage = """%prog [options] [<dir>] |
31 | ||
32 | Export the applied patches into a given directory (defaults to | |
23a88c7d | 33 | 'patches') in a standard unified GNU diff format. A template file |
94d18868 YD |
34 | (defaulting to '.git/patchexport.tmpl' or |
35 | '~/.stgit/templates/patchexport.tmpl' or | |
36 | '/usr/share/stgit/templates/patchexport.tmpl') can be used for the | |
23a88c7d CM |
37 | patch format. The following variables are supported in the template |
38 | file: | |
26aab5b0 CM |
39 | |
40 | %(description)s - patch description | |
99e73103 CM |
41 | %(shortdescr)s - the first line of the patch description |
42 | %(longdescr)s - the rest of the patch description, after the first line | |
26aab5b0 CM |
43 | %(diffstat)s - the diff statistics |
44 | %(authname)s - author's name | |
45 | %(authemail)s - author's e-mail | |
46 | %(authdate)s - patch creation date | |
47 | %(commname)s - committer's name | |
48 | %(commemail)s - committer's e-mail | |
49 | ||
50 | 'export' can also generate a diff for a range of patches.""" | |
